Commercial Land Clearing in Salt Lake City, UT
Commercial land clearing services involve the removal of trees, shrubs, stumps, and other vegetation to prepare a property for development, construction, or landscaping projects. These services are suitable for a variety of projects, including building sites, parking lots, outdoor facilities, or agricultural land. Property owners typically seek land clearing to create a level, accessible space, eliminate obstacles, or comply with zoning and building requirements. Before requesting land clearing, it’s helpful to understand the size and scope of the area, the types of vegetation present, and any permits or regulations that may apply in the Salt Lake City area.
Property owners should also consider the potential impact on existing structures, utilities, or drainage systems during the clearing process. Clarifying the desired end use of the land can help determine the most appropriate clearing methods and extent of work needed. Additionally, understanding any environmental restrictions or property boundaries can ensure the project proceeds smoothly and in compliance with local guidelines. Proper planning and communication about these details can facilitate an efficient and effective land clearing process.

Commercial Land Clearing Questions
What types of land can be cleared commercially? Commercial land clearing services typically handle sites with trees, shrubs, and debris, preparing properties for development or construction projects.
Why is land clearing important before development? Clearing removes obstacles and prepares the land for building, ensuring a safe and level foundation for future construction.
What equipment is used for commercial land clearing? Heavy machinery such as bulldozers, excavators, and loaders are commonly used to efficiently clear large areas.
Are there permits required for land clearing projects? Local regulations may require permits or approvals before starting land clearing, especially for larger or commercial sites.
